WebAug 23, 2012 · If you don’t want the download the free rate calculator above, the math goes like this: Total Monthly Living Expenses = L Total Monthly Business Expenses = B Total Billable Hours Per Month = H Total Taxes (%) = T Your Minimum Hourly Rate = L/[H * (1 – T)] + B/H Example: So let’s say you need to make $5,000/month to live, expect your …
